摘要:
##前端导读 ##HTML5 ##标签 <table border="1" cellspacing="0" cellpadding="10"> <caption>表格标题</caption> <thead> <tr> <th>标题</th> <th>标题</th> <th>标题</th> <th>标 阅读全文
摘要:
##ORM介绍 ##ORM单例模式 from orm_singleton.mysql_singleton import Mysql # 定义字段类 class Field(object): def __init__(self, name, column_type, primary_key, defa 阅读全文
摘要:
##数据库备份 ##数据库高性能优化案例学习 阅读全文
摘要:
##sqlalchemy ##架构与流程图 阅读全文
摘要:
##存储引擎 ##索引 ##慢日志查询(slow log) ##普通日志记录(general log) ##权限管理 ##explain 工具介绍 阅读全文
摘要:
##Navicat介绍 ##pymysql模块 ##事务 ##视图 ##函数 一、数学函数 ROUND(x,y) 返回参数x的四舍五入的有y位小数的值 RAND() 返回0到1内的随机值,可以通过提供一个参数(种子)使RAND()随机数生成器生成一个指定的值。 二、聚合函数(常用于GROUP BY从 阅读全文
摘要:
##Mysql基本语法(二) #一对一: 左表的一条记录唯一对应右表的一条记录,反之也一样 create table customer( id int primary key auto_increment, name char(20) not null, qq char(10) not null, 阅读全文
摘要:
##Mysql基本语法(一) not null 不能为空 default 设置默认值 mysql中存在一种专门的数据结构,叫key,又称为索引,通过该数据结构可以减少io次数,从而加速查询效率 index key : 只有加速查询的效果,没有约束的功能 unique key:不仅有加速查询的效果,还 阅读全文
摘要:
##内容回顾 多线程会遇到资源瓶颈,什么才是解决高并发最有效的方式呢 linux中提供了epoll 这种多路复用的IO模型,注意其他平台没有相应的实现 所以epoll仅在linux中可用 ##epoll ##epoll相关函数 ##epoll案例 #coding:utf-8import select 阅读全文
摘要:
##内容回顾 #基于协程的套接字 ## IO模型 ##阻塞IO模型 默认情况下所有的socket都是blocking 网络IO中必经的两个阶段 ##非阻塞IO模型(non-blocking IO) 非阻塞IO模型 ##多路复用IO模型(IO multiplexing) 多路复用基本原理就是selec 阅读全文